33问答网
所有问题
当前搜索:
vba数组去重 写到新数组
在VBA中
如何用一个
数组
给另一个数组赋值?
答:
1.首先在Excel电子表格中选择要分配
数组
的单元格。2.n、在界面中,点击“insert”和“formcontrol”中的“button”选项。3.在接口版本的表中生成按钮控件,修改控制的名字。4.接下来,在界面中,点击“查看代码”选项。5.
在VBA
接口中继续,并输入定义一维数组的语句。6.然后,在VBA接口中,输入一...
Excel VBA
如何删除
数组
中重复的值?
答:
使用集合Collection的key唯一性除
去重
复的值 Sub A()Dim A(1 To 100)Dim b As New Collection Dim i As Integer A(1) = 1 A(2) = 3 A(3) = 5 A(4) = 7 A(5) = 3 A(6) = 5 A(7) = 2 On Error Resume Next For i = 1 To 100 b.Add A(i), Str(A(i))Next ...
vba
代码中有二维动态
数组
S,第1次重定义为50行,但由于只用到j行
答:
你第一次重定义的时候,一定要把可变的维数定义
在
最后一维,比如 ReDim s(1 To 2, 1 To 50)然后第二次重定义的时候就可以 Redim Preserve s(1 To 2, 1 To j)强调:重定义动态
数组
时,要想保持数组中原有的数据,只能修改最后一维的维数!
VBA
数据库结果 遍历替换成
新的数组
?
答:
具体的代码要有具体的使用场景,具体的文件
Excel vba中
怎么去除一维
数组
中重复的数据
答:
遍历
数组
,通过字典
去除重复
数据
vba中
怎么去除
数组
中重复的数据
答:
2个办法:方法一:对数据的元素进行依次遍历,如果已经存在,则将其移除。方法二:将数据
写到
单元格区域中,调用excel中
去重
复值方法,然后再读进来。
用VBA
如何把二维
数组
空值去除,同时其他有值再赋给另一区域,请大家多多...
答:
Sub 重设
数组
() Dim ar(10) As Range, br(10) As Range Set ra = ActiveSheet.UsedRange For i = 1 To 10 Set ar(i - 1) = ra.Rows(i) If Not Cells(i, 1) = Empty Then Set br(a) = ar(i - 1) br(a).Copy Cells(a + 1, 5) a = a + ...
Vba数组去重
复请教
答:
字典最合适,代码如下:Sub AA()arr = Range("B2:B10")Set d = CreateObject("scripting.dictionary")For i = 1 To UBound(arr)d(arr(i, 1)) = ""Next [C2].Resize(d.Count) = Application.Transpose(d.keys)Set d = Nothing End Sub ...
Excel vba
求助一个
数组
写入另一个数组
答:
例如将Ar
数组
中的数据写入Br中 主要代码:for i=1 to ubound(ar)br(i-1)=ar(i-1)next i
Excel VBA
如何删除
数组
中重复的值?
答:
使用集合Collection的key唯一性除
去重
复的值 Sub A()Dim A(1 To 100)Dim b As New Collection Dim i As Integer A(1) = 1 A(2) = 3 A(3) = 5 A(4) = 7 A(5) = 3 A(6) = 5 A(7) = 2 On Error Resume Next For i = 1 To 100 b.Add A(i), Str(A(i))Next ...
1
2
3
4
5
6
7
8
9
10
涓嬩竴椤
灏鹃〉
其他人还搜
vba数组去重复用哪个函数好
vba查找数组重复值
vba删除重复值
vba中把一列值赋给另一列
vb二维数组去重
vb循环去重放入数组
vba将一个数组存入另一数组
vba字典去重计数求和
vba查找重复值